Size and Weight Comparison
The size of a lens is a crucial factor to consider when comparing two lenses. Sigma 70-200mm F2.8 EX DG OS HSM is the longer of the two lenses at 197mm. The HD Pentax-FA 77mm F1.8 Ltd with a length of 48mm, is 149mm shorter. Besides being longer, the Sigma 70-200mm F2.8 EX DG OS HSM also has a larger diameter of 86mm compared to the HD Pentax-FA 77mm F1.8 Ltd's 64mm diameter.
The weight of a lens is equally significant as its external dimensions, particularly if you intend to handhold your camera and lens combination for extended periods. HD Pentax-FA 77mm F1.8 Ltd weighs 270g, which means it is 1160g (81%) lighter than the Sigma 70-200mm F2.8 EX DG OS HSM which has a weight of 1430g.
Filter Threads
The HD Pentax-FA 77mm F1.8 Ltd has a filter size of 49mm whereas the Sigma 70-200mm F2.8 EX DG OS HSM has a 77mm diameter. Larger filters are generally more expensive than the smaller ones given all the other features are equal.

Lens Mounts
The HD Pentax-FA 77mm F1.8 Ltd has the Pentax KAF lens mount whereas the Sigma 70-200mm F2.8 EX DG OS HSM has the Pentax KAF3 lens mount. Some of the latest released cameras that are compatible with these mounts are Pentax K-3 III Mono, Pentax KF and Pentax K-3 III for the Pentax KAF Mount and Pentax K-3 III Mono, Pentax KF and Pentax K-3 III for the Pentax KAF3 Mount.
Sigma 70-200mm F2.8 EX DG OS HSM is also available in Canon EF , Nikon F (FX), Sony Alpha and Sigma SA mounts.
Focal Range
HD Pentax-FA 77mm F1.8 Ltd is a prime lens with fixed focal lenght of 77mm. When it is mounted on an APS-C sensor camera with 1.5x crop, it provides a 35mm (FF) equivalent of
115.5mm.
On the other hand, the Sigma 70-200mm F2.8 EX DG OS HSM has a focal range of 70-200mm and 2.9X zoom ratio . When it is mounted on an APS-C sensor camera with 1.5x crop, it provides a 35mm (FF) equivalent of 105 - 300mm.
